Pair of Aesthetic Movement Cast Iron Fireplaces, Attributed to T Jeckyll

SOLD

A pair of aesthetic movement cast iron fireplaces with a peacock sat on a tray above a wind God attributed to Thomas Jeckyll and probably made by Barnard Bishop and Barnard.

Year of manufacture
1875
Designer
Thomas Jeckyll
Period
Aesthetic Movement
